Originally Posted by mercu136
What is it about the 96 you dont like? I have the same bike (09 SG) and I dont have any issues w it. Runs strong, pulls hard. How much power is enough (if there is such a thing)?
I traded a Dyna with a 96" that had a stage 1 for the sig bike in my pic (it has an SE 103 motor with 2-1 Bub exhaust). I can honestly say that there is not all that much difference in power between the two bikes. A stage 1 96" motor has lots of low end torque to begin with.
